Hey all,
I have been using OpenSUSE 10.3 as my main boot for a few days now, and I finally installed STEAM and Team Fortress 2 through Wine a couple days ago. I came across a very weird problem with Team Fortress 2. When I run the game though the Games tab on STEAM, I get a pretty serious graphics issue. The loading screen (with the Valve logo and Source information) of the game alternately loads for about 1/2 a second, and then stops for like 1/2 a second. Then once I get to the main screen for the game, I have an even crazier graphics issue: the background image is stretched beyond recognition and the text is illegible. The resolution for the game is also changed to 640x480 in game, and when the game closes, it stays that way on SUSE completely until I manually change it.
Example of Main Screen =>
http://smg.photobucket.com/albums/v3...reenshot-2.png
I'm using OpenSUSE 10.3 with all the updates installed. I'm also using Wine 1.0-rc1 to run both STEAM and Team Fortress. I'm not very familiar with Wine on Linux and driver compatibility in general. It would be a great help to resolve this problem (so I don't have to switch to Windows to play a game, and then switch back to Linux to do mostly, everything else).
Thank you in advance!
~Unseen Ghost
EDIT:
I just found out the solution after some searching around with drivers: my NVIDIA drivers were not the most recent version which caused very bad problems with TF2 when played through STEAM. All that needs to be done (in case anyone else runs into this problem) is update your drivers.
Link:
http://en.opensuse.org/Nvidia